针对企业异构信息在资源数量上和载体种类上不断攀升的情况,为了实现对全部异构信息资源进行统一检索并满足检索效率要求,设计了一个基于Solr的飞机故障异构信息检索系统。该系统首先针对异构信息特点设计索引结构,实现统一检索;然后并将各类异构数据按其对应索引结构生成索引文件,并导入至索引信息库,实现信息融合;最后基于Solr J API进行系统开发,实现各类复杂搜索功能,并结合专业词汇权重优化排序结果。实验结果证明,该系统能满足多种复杂搜索需求,有效解决了对企业异构信息资源的检索问题,为企业做出快速决策提供了技术支持。
In order to realize the uniform retrieval of all heterogeneous information resources and meet the retrieval efficiency requirements, a heterogeneous information retrieval system based on Solr is designed to deal with the increasing number of heterogeneous information and carrier types. The system first designs the index structure according to the characteristics of heterogeneous information and implements unified retrieval. Then it generates index files according to the corresponding index structure and imports them into the index information base to realize the information fusion. Finally, based on the Solr J API System development, to achieve all kinds of complex search functions, combined with professional vocabulary optimization sorting results. The experimental results show that the system can meet a variety of complex search needs, effectively solve the problem of enterprise heterogeneous information retrieval, and provide technical support for enterprises to make rapid decisions.
